In this interview, I speak with James Gagliano, former FBI Supervisory Special Agent and law enforcement analyst, about the assassination of Charlie Kirk. We discuss what went wrong with security, how investigators handled the early confusion, and why cases like this often involve very young perpetrators. Gagliano also shares his insights on the manhunt, the suspect’s surrender, and how evidence such as engraved cartridge messages can help investigators understand a killer’s mindset. Together, we explore: Security and protective-detail failures The investigative process and challenges faced by the FBI The suspect’s psychology and behavioral patterns How public reactions and political polarization affect such cases The long-term implications for security, politics, and freedom of speech in the U.S. This is a nonpartisan, fact-based discussion aimed at understanding how law enforcement investigates tragedies of this scale.
